Block

#21,114,558
Block Number
21,114,558 @ 03/11/2025, 06:29:20
Status
Finalized
ID
0x01422ebec954b6441af7ce856bbbbdde3d07bf156e5ef51381ecc543fa0514d1
Transactions
Gas Used
7458009/40000000 (18.65% Used)
Total Score
2,061,487,173 (+98)
Rewards
26.76 VTHO